Classic instant messenger with multi-functional communication tools

ICQ Pro 2003b build revisits the roots of instant messaging with a robust combination of real-time chat, file sharing, and extended communication features. Favored by users nostalgic for early internet culture as well as those seeking a reliable and resource-light IM client, ICQ Pro 2003b showcases a comprehensive set of functions tailored for both casual and professional users.

Comprehensive Contact Management

ICQ Pro 2003b excels in organizing and maintaining contact lists. Users can search for friends and colleagues on the ICQ network using multiple identifiers including ICQ number, name, nickname, or email address. Once set up, the program provides instant notifications when contacts come online, supporting real-time interaction. The ability to manage custom groupings and assign individualized alerts makes it straightforward to keep track of busy contact lists.

Multiple Messaging and Communication Options

Beyond text-based chat, ICQ Pro 2003b includes extensive options for sending files, URLs, and even playing games directly within the chat environment. The presence of ICQphone introduces IP telephony, letting users make PC-to-PC and PC-to-phone calls — a rarity among early-instant messengers. Additional options for SMS and wireless pager messages expand its communication reach. The integration with Outlook streamlines email access and supports better workflow management for users who handle both messaging and emails in tandem.

User Experience and Interface

The interface balances feature density with accessibility. With an enhanced user interface tailored even for Windows XP, the software supports automatic firewall detection to reduce setup hassles. Users can transition between the Pro and Lite versions by simply selecting “Switch to ICQ Lite” from the main menu, preserving all preferences and passwords for a smooth transition across versions.

Enhanced Features and Integrations

Enhancements in this build include improved email integration, better channel updates, and a dedicated window for direct Google searches without leaving the ICQ interface. These features aim to unify essential productivity tools and information streams within a familiar instant messaging client.

Performance and Compatibility

ICQ Pro 2003b is designed to function efficiently on legacy Windows systems, ensuring that resource consumption remains light, even on older PCs. Compatibility with Windows XP is notably improved in this build, though users on modern operating systems may encounter limitations or require compatibility mode adjustments.

Legacy and Modern Utility

While this version may lack the end-to-end encryption and advanced media-sharing capabilities expected in contemporary messaging platforms, it retains appeal for those prioritizing simplicity, nostalgia, and reliable basic communication.
